- What should the customer know about your pricing (e.g., discounts, fees)?
I charge $50 a person/ $100 an hr. I can do 2 ppl an hr. Lashes are included/but optional. I charge for travel. I simply GPS it and charge my hrly rate based on travel time. I give the bride hers free when her whole party is included (min 5 women) It is customary to receive tips for services rendered. Since makeup is a service industry I am tipped. The average is 20-30% of the total.
